    So I'm going in for my 10000 mile service and was looking for more to say to my service tech. I have had problems with my sunroof leaking. I took it in a while ago and so far they have adjusted it and replaced it with a new one. I called the 800 Toyota number and they escalated the problem and sent a service tech for my area. I live in Michigan and he drove all the way up from Ohio just to spend only a couple of hours on it. He actually told me he did some adjustments and that it doesn't leak as bad as the other 2016 Tacoma they had on the lot. Like that was supposed to make me feel better. So he didn't do anymore with the sunroof and said that it is an acceptable amount of water that Toyota allows to enter the vehicle. It cracks me up that people say their sunroof is fine when I posted a while back ago but no one has done the test I have done. That is to put four paper towels in all four corners of the sunroof, go through a touch less car wash and see if the paper towels are dry. In my situation one of the four paper towels is soaked enough to ring it out and the other three are damp. I understand that going through a high-powered wash is a little extreme but I also get the same results in the rain. I've done the same test with my 06 Malibu And all four paper towels are dry. I would love Toyota to put in parentheses that if purchased with a sunroof there will be an acceptable amount of water entering the vehicle. I wonder how much they would sell then. I bet A lot of you sunroof owners didn't even know Toyota use that terminology. I wouldn't even of noticed it if I didn't put the paper towels up there and the just looking at it you won't notice it either. So I would say PLEASE do this to see if it leaks. The rep told me Toyota won't do anything major it there is not enough complaints. The drain holes are doing their job and water is not entering the cabin but that seems like a lot of water coming in when my Malibu with drain holes doesn't have water coming in at all. My sump pump to my house doesn't have that much water coming in.
